Walnut Family

Definition

1) 'Walnut Family' can refer to:
2) A family of flowering plants known as Juglandaceae, which includes trees such as walnuts, hickories, and pecans.
3) A botanical classification grouping different species of trees that produce edible nuts encased in a hard shell.
4) A group of related trees that share similar characteristics in terms of leaf shape, fruit structures, and growth habits.
